function loaddiv(ttype)
{
document.getElementById('rent').style.display='none';
switch (ttype)
{
case 1:
for ( var i=1;i<=4;i++ )
{
if ( i == 1 )
{
document.getElementById('rent'+i).style.display='';
}
else
{
document.getElementById('rent'+i).style.display='none';
}
}
break;
case 2:
for ( var i=1;i<=4;i++ )
{
if ( i == 2 )
{
document.getElementById('rent'+i).style.display='';
}
else
{
document.getElementById('rent'+i).style.display='none';
}
}
break;
case 3:
for ( var i=1;i<=4;i++ )
{
if ( i == 3 )
{
document.getElementById('rent'+i).style.display='';
}
else
{
document.getElementById('rent'+i).style.display='none';
}
}
break;
case 4:
for ( var i=1;i<=4;i++ )
{
if ( i == 4 )
{
document.getElementById('rent'+i).style.display='';
}
else
{
document.getElementById('rent'+i).style.display='none';
}
}
break;
}
}

解决方案 »

  1.   

    想了想还有个跟简单的,贴出
    function loaddiv(ttype)
    {
    document.getElementById('rent').style.display='none';
    for ( var i=1;i<=4;i++ )
    {
    if ( i == ttype )
    {
    document.getElementById('rent'+i).style.display='';
    }
    else
    {
    document.getElementById('rent'+i).style.display='none';
    }
    }
    }
      

  2.   

    function loaddiv(ttype)
    {
    document.getElementById('rent').style.display='none';for ( var i=1;i<=4;i++ )
    {
    if ( i == ttype )document.getElementById('rent'+i).style.display='';elsedocument.getElementById('rent'+i).style.display='none';}
    }
      

  3.   

    把rent改为rent0就可以继续简化了,目前这样到位了